Introduction
Gingr provides several reports to help you review and manage subscriptions, packages, and their associated components. These reports give insight into active subscriptions, canceled subscriptions, and outstanding package components so you can track usage, remaining values, and expiration timelines.
Reporting & Location Access
Reports in Gingr use location-based reporting. Results are calculated based on the locations selected in the report rather than displaying data for all locations by default. Each report indicates the type of location it uses, which determines how results are calculated.
Common location types include:
Booking Location – Where the reservation or appointment takes place
Invoice Location – Where revenue and financial activity are attributed
Spend Location – Where the pet parent’s purchases and charges occurred
Package Purchase Location – Where a package or subscription was purchased
Subscription Location – Where the subscription is enrolled
Transaction Location – Where the payment was processed
Pet Parent Home Location – The pet parent’s assigned home location
Available locations in a report are determined by the user’s Allowed Locations. Users can only view and report on locations they are explicitly allowed to access. If a location does not appear as an option, verify the user’s Allowed Locations configuration before running the report.
